DeepLearning MuLi Notes

This project is a deep learning study resource and educational curriculum designed for mastering neural network architectures and theory. It serves as a learning platform that combines theoretical notes and mathematical formulas with practical code implementations.

The curriculum is centered on the PyTorch framework, providing a structured path for building and training models through annotated code examples and technical reviews of mathematical foundations.

The resource utilizes interactive notebooks for executing machine learning algorithms and experimenting with data models. Theoretical content is delivered via a navigable web interface that renders markdown and mathematical notation.
